How do you register for an SBI Card online?
Let us suppose you hold an SBI Elite Credit Card and want to get the same registered; in that case, you need to follow the below-mentioned steps:
Step 1: Go to the website www.sbicard.com.
Step 2: Click on the tab โFirst Time Userโ.
Step 3: Provide some details, such as the Credit card number, CVV number, card expiry date, and cardholder’s date of birth.
Step 4: Click the tab โProceedโ.
Step 5: Fill in the OTP that is received on the registered mobile.
Step 6: Click โProceedโ.
Step 7: Provide the preferred User ID along with the password, and then confirm the same password.
Step 8: The username and password are now generated.
Step 9: To access the services in the SBI online account, visit www.sbicard.com and log in using your credentials.
Steps to Activate SBI Internet Banking
Mentioned below are the steps to get SBI Internet Banking activated:
- Visit the official web portal of SBI for internet banking (https://www.onlinesbi.sbi/)
- Click โPersonal Banking Loginโ.
- Now, click the tab โNew User Registration/ Activationโ.
- Provide your registered mobile number, account number, branch code, CIF number, branch code, and country code.
- Now, under the option โFacility neededโ, select either โViewโ, โRestricted Transactionsโ, or โFull Transactionsโ.
- Click on โI agree to the terms and conditionsโ.
- Provide the OTP received on the mobile number registered with the bank.ย
- If you have an ATM card, the registration can be completed, and internet banking services can be enabled.
- Select the option โI have my ATM Cardโ and click โSubmitโ.
- Validate your debit card by verifying the ATM card credentials.
- Create your permanent username.
- Create a Login password. Click โSubmitโ.
- The registration is completed.

Steps to Add SBI Credit Card using Internet Banking
Let us suppose you hold an SBI Cashback Credit Card and want to add the same using Internet banking; follow the below-mentioned steps:
Step 1: With the help of an user ID and password, get access to internet banking of SBI.
Step 2: Click the tab โBill Paymentsโ.
Step 3: Now click on the tab โManage Billerโ.
Step 4: Under the tab โManage Billerโ, click the option โAddโ.
Step 5: Now, click on โAll India Billersโ and then select SBI Card.
Step 6: To register the biller information, provide the name and credit card number. Now click โSubmit.โ
Step 7: Now, an OTP will be received on the registered mobile number.
Step 8: Next, provide the OTP and give consent to the biller information provided.

How to Reset SBI Credit Card PIN?
- Via Online Mode:
Mentioned below are the steps to reset your SBI card PIN online:
Step 1: Open the SBI card website i.e. www.sbicard.com.
Step 2: Log in to the SBI card online account.
Step 3: Now, click โMy Accountโ.
Step 4: Choose the option โManage PINโ.
Step 5: Choose from the drop-down menu the credit card for which the PIN is to be changed.
Step 6: Provide the OTP received on your registered mobile number.
Step 7: Now, provide the new credit card PIN.
Step 8: Click on โSubmitโ. The Pin is now successfully reset.
- Through IVR:
Mentioned below are the steps to reset your SBI card PIN through IVR:
Step 1: Call 3902 02 02 (prefix local STD code) or 1860 180 1290 to reset the credit card PIN.
Step 2: Press number โ6โ to enter the credit card details along with the Date of birth.
Step 3: Validate the OTP received on the registered E-mail ID and mobile number to reset the PIN.
How to make SBI Credit Card Bill Payment through Paynet?
Mentioned below are the steps to make an SBI credit card bill payment through the Paynet option available online:
Step 1: Log in to the official SBI card portal.
Step 2: On the Dashboard, click โPay Nowโ.
Step 3: Enter the desired amount to be paid.
Step 4: Validate the details and then authorise the payment via the bankโs payment interface.
Step 5: The bank account will then be debited online, and a Transaction Reference Number (TRN) will be auto-generated, containing the details of the transaction done.
Step 6: The TRN will be received on the registered mobile number and e-mail ID.
